An economy is the wealth and resources of a country or region, especially in terms of the production and consumption of goods and service. Economy branches off into many economic systems. An economic system is the way of organizing the production and consumption of goods. Currently, there are four main economic systems. These systems consist of a traditional economic system, where the decisions about what to produce and how to produce them are based on customs, beliefs, and traditions. Command economy, where the decisions on what to produce and how to produce them are made by the central government. Market economy, where the decisions on what to produce and how to produce them mainly rely on markets. And mixed economy, a combination of market and command.
